keynoTe presenTaTion feaTuring york risk serviCes:

“Evolving Role of the CFO”

The role of the CFO has been evolving and has never been as critical as it is now. The business world, disrupted by digital and globalization, is changing fast and the stakes are high – the power of decisions can impact a company irreparably and the factors for foresight in decision making are vast - CFOs are in this unique position, beyond the CEO, to step up to chief decision support officers to help steer the company forward. CFOs are being called to action to create value, develop strategy and:

• Manage disruption and lead change

• Become a creative visionary who is grounded firmly in the facts while being able to partner with the CEO on supporting the vision

• Understand of whole business and the key outcome metrics (not just financial) – Customer Experience, Talent, Brand, Competitive Intelligence, Efficiency of Business Processes (not just in Finance)

• Become an advisor, operator and enabler

Participate in this thought provoking session for a dialog on:

• Traditional Role. A traditional CFO, and how is it different from the modern day CFO?

• Evolution. Why has the CFO’s role changed over time?

• Key Skills: What are the three key skills every modern-day CFO should possess, and why?

• Challenges. What particular challenges do you face as a finance leader?

• Culture. Views on company culture? How do you bring the accounting & finance team together?

• Lessons. What are the most important learnings about being a finance leader?

• Tips. Tips for the next generation of CFO’s / aspiring finance leaders.

panel disCussion:

“Emphasizing Human Capital in Finance for Long-term Success”

Session topics include but are not limited to:

• What are ways that today’s CFOs can attract new talent to the finance function, especially Millennials and Gen Z?

• Which skills and traits should CFOs seek in identifying and cultivating the modern finance talent pipeline?

• What challenges does your organization face in identifying, securing, and mentoring talent? How are you collaborating with the HR function to overcome these challenges?

• What are some best practices for promoting diversity in finance function in every stage of pipeline?

• What are some best practices for evaluating finance team’s capabilities and strengths and for identifying opportunities for further training and development?

• How can the CFO promote professional development opportunities to keep finance teams engaged and interested?
